Evaluating Tirzepatide for Body Management

Several innovative drugs, including Tirzepatide, are showing significant potential in body reduction. Semaglutide primarily acts upon GLP-1 receptors, while Tirzepatide combines GLP-1 and GIP receptor activation, potentially leading to greater outcomes. A triple agonist moreover incorporates GIP, GLP-1, and GCGR receptor function, suggesting a potential edge regarding body control versus the other choices. Ultimately, the preferred approach necessitates individualized evaluation by a medical practitioner to determine the appropriate treatment plan.

Understanding GLP-1 Peptide Drugs : Benefits & Things to Keep in Mind

GLP-1 drugs represent a crucial development in managing ailments like type 2 diabetes and obesity . These innovative therapies work by mimicking the action of a natural hormone in the body, stimulating glucose secretion when sugar levels are increased. In addition to their primary role of managing blood sugar, they can also aid weight loss and enhance heart-related wellness .

  • Such often lead to modest fat reduction.
  • Likely side consequences can include nausea, vomiting , and loose stools .
  • It is vital to consult with a physician provider before initiating any different treatment.
Always remember that GLP-1 medications are not a alternative for a balanced lifestyle and consistent exercise; they are intended to be a component of a complete treatment approach .
